Understanding Business Credit
Before diving into the process of establishing business credit, it’s essential to understand what business credit is and why it’s crucial for your business. Business credit is similar to personal credit but is specifically for businesses. It’s an evaluation of how well your business manages its finances and credit obligations. Business credit scores are used by lenders and suppliers to determine the creditworthiness of your business.
Steps to Establish Business Credit
Establishing business credit takes time and effort, but it’s worth the investment. Here are the steps to establish business credit:
1. Incorporate Your Business
Incorporating your business is the first step to separate your business from your personal finances. By incorporating, your business becomes a separate legal entity, and you can obtain an Employer Identification Number (EIN) from the IRS. An EIN is used to identify your business for tax purposes and to open a business bank account.
2. Open a Business Bank Account
Opening a business bank account is essential to keep your business finances separate from your personal finances. It also provides a clear record of your business expenses and revenue, which is necessary for building business credit. When opening a business bank account, ensure that you choose a bank that reports to credit bureaus.
3. Obtain a Business Credit Card
A business credit card is a valuable tool to establish business credit. Use it to make regular purchases and pay off the balance on time. Ensure that the credit card is in the name of your business and not in your name. It’s essential to keep the credit utilization ratio low, ideally below 30% of the credit limit.
4. Establish Trade Credit
Trade credit refers to credit extended by vendors and suppliers to businesses. It’s an excellent way to establish business credit, as trade credit accounts are reported to credit bureaus. Start by opening accounts with suppliers who are willing to extend credit to your business. Ensure that you make payments on time and maintain a good relationship with your suppliers.
5. Monitor and Improve Your Credit Score
Regularly monitor your business credit score and credit report to ensure that there are no errors or inaccuracies. It’s essential to pay bills on time and keep your credit utilization ratio low. Building a good credit history takes time and effort, but it’s worth it in the long run.
